The Necessity of Atheism was first published by Shelley in 1811. In 1813 he printed a revised and expanded version of it as one of the notes to his poem Queen Mab.

Shelley evinced a searing contempt for organized religion but maintained a belief in a benevolent non-sectarian World Spirit.

in the opening statement of this pamphlet, he makes clear the nature of his qualified deism:

"There is no God. This negation must be understood solely to affect a creative Deity. The hypothesis of a pervading Spirit co-eternal with the universe remains unshaken."
